Position Summary:
We seek an experienced and strategic Director of Product to lead our product management team as they build custom software solutions for our adjusters, contractors, back-office staff, carrier clients, and policyholders. The Director of Product will have a unique opportunity to oversee two key initiatives that will impact the business for years to come. One focused on claim data integration between carriers and service providers, and the other focused on driving innovation in the claim inspection process. This role will be critical in defining and executing the product vision, ensuring alignment with the company's growth objectives and customer needs. The Director of Product will collaborate across software engineering, design, operations, and business teams to drive innovation and ensure successful software product delivery. The underlying technology stacks are supported by Angular, Vue, .NET, Java, and native mobile applications.Β The role is hybrid, offering flexibility between remote work and in-office engagement.
